卵形体农产品大小头自动定向翻转运动仿真模型建立与试验验证 被引量:1

Establishment and experimental verification of simulation model on turnover motion of ovoid agricultural products

摘要 为了深入探讨卵形体农产品大小头自动定向中翻转运动规律的影响因素和动力学特性,降低实际试验成本,设计了由卵形体、输送辊、导向杆组成的数字化虚拟样机(仿真模型),并运用ADAMS运动仿真技术对卵形体翻转运动过程进行了仿真,创建了翻滚距离和导向杆作用距离仿真值的测量方法;在此基础上,对不同长轴L、短轴B、蛋形角θ和输送辊中心距E、导向杆弯曲角度γ、输送速度v条件下仿真值和实际试验值进行比较分析。结果表明,仿真结果与实测结果呈现相同的变化规律,相对误差均在10%以内,所建的仿真模型是可信和有效的,利用该模型研究翻转运动规律是可行的。 In order to further explore the influential factors and dynamic characteristics of turnover motion in the automatic orientation of pointed end and blunt end of the ovoid agricultural products,to reduce actual test costs,a digital virtual prototype(simulation model)consisting of ovoid products,conveying roller and guide rod is designed and built.Using the ADAMS simulation technology,the process of the ovoid body,turnover motion is simulated,and a measurement method for the rolling distance and effect distance of guide rod in the simulation experiment is created.On this basis,the simulation values and actual test values under different long axis L,short axis B,egg-shaped angleθ,center distance E of the conveying roller,bending angleγof the guide rod,and conveying speed v are compared and ana-lyzed.The results show that the actual results and the simulation results have the same variation discipline,and the relative error is within 10%.The established simulation model is credible and efficacious,using this model to study the discipline of turnover motion is feasible.It lays the foundation for the research of the oval body agricultural products turnover motion simulation.
